I was recently introduced to a children's music artist who has a very folksy feel! Her name is Mary Kaye and she has been writing children's music for about 10 years! She has a brand new album that will be released July 2nd titled Music Box. Learn a little more about Mary Kaye here:"When I was a child, I was so shy that I didn't talk in kindergarten. (I would talk at home, but not at school.) The teacher suggested that I take theatre classes. Lucky for me, there was a theatre right across from my house, so my mom would walk me across the street and I would take classes. I kind of grew up with this theatre company. I would see all of the shows and was the "kid" in quite a few of them. Theatre became a way for me to come out of my shell and finally start talking in public. I was in the chorus as a "townsfolk" person in almost every musical you can imagine. Some favorites were Carousel, Oklahoma, and The King And I (where I had my very first line.) My first line was, "Tell us, Mrs. Anna,...what to do when afraid?" (I had a speech problem with my Rs back t
hen, so I actually said, "Tell us, Mrs. Anna,...what to do when afwaid?") Anna (the character) answered in a song called, "Whistle a happy tune." Her message was that music could help you...so I have always taken that to heart. I spent some time as a professional actress and that is how I met my husband who is an actor/director and is now also a professor of theatre. I taught theatre to children with several of the company's I worked with and ended up going back to school to get my Master's in elementary education. As a teacher, I integrated the arts into the curriculum whenever I could. I found that theatre and art became a tool to help a lot of kids express themselves in ways they never could before. I was teaching a poetry unit with my fifth grade class and was inspired by the poems my students were writing. I told them, that if they wanted me to, I would put their work into a poetry play with music. I put out a folder on my desk for their poems and it was soon overflowing. Every student added a poem to the folder. That is when I started writing music. The poetry play had masks and dance and puppets and MUSIC.
I have two elementary age daughters, now, and have been staying home with them and writing music about our adventures together. They teach me new things every day. Most of the songs on this record are about something one of them said or did. Family is probably my favorite song on this CD, because it is so autobiographical. This is my fourth CD of music for children, so I guess I have been writing kids' music for almost ten years. My husband and I tour a children's theatre/music piece with my songs in it. It is wonderful to meet different families, and it brings me tremendous joy to see kids dancing and singing along to the songs I have written.
We live in Maine and love to walk along the ocean."
Graham really loves the very first song on her new album! It is titled Under the Moon and talks about all of the animals that walk under the moon. The fun part about the song is it includes sound effects that you would hear from these animals and starts to become a fun round! A lot of Mary Kaye's songs on the Music Box album involve different simple sounds that Graham enjoys listening to.
Like I said earlier, she has a folksy feel to me that is very natural. It is definitely a different style of kids music than what Graham is already listening to. I love that she tells stories with her music, stories that kids can understand and relate to. We also love how she gets you up and moving with her silly beats!
